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om North Area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in North Area with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in North Area is at Island Drive listed at $1,920.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om North Area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in North Area is $2,195.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om North Area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in North Area is a 1,596 square feet unit starting from $1,657 at The Yard.

What is the average size for North Area 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in North Area is currently 1,200 sq ft.
